May 2025 - Apr 2026Ryecroft Avenue area has the 2nd lowest crime rate of 29 local areas in Heathfield , and the 77th lowest crime rate of 592 local areas in Richmond upon Thames .
This postcode forms a relatively safe pocket compared with the surrounding streets. Neighbouring areas record much higher crime levels, even though this postcode itself remains comparatively low-crime.
The overall crime rate in the area around Ryecroft Avenue (TW2 6HH) in the last 12 months was 18.1 per 1,000 residents and was 78.9% lower than the Heathfield average (86.0 per 1,000 residents). In the last 12 months, this area’s most reported crimes were Anti-social behaviour with 3 offences recorded. The least common crime was Violent crimes with 1 case , unchanged from 2025. The fastest-growing crime category was Anti-social behaviour ( 200.0% YoY). The sharpest decline was Vehicle crime ( -33.3% YoY).
Violent crimes totalled 1 (≈ 2.6 per 1,000 residents). Year-over-year these were flat ( 0.0% ). Over the last decade, overall crime has falling ( -33.3% comparing early vs recent averages) .
In the area around Ryecroft Avenue (TW2 6HH), the main crime hotspot is near Ross Road. Police recorded 35 crimes here, including 14 violent or public-order offences. All these locations are within roughly 0.3 miles.
